BACKGROUND: Chinese herbal medicine is increasingly widely used as a complementary approach for control of breast cancer recurrence and metastasis. In this paper, we examined the implicit prescription patterns behind the Chinese medicinal formulae, so as to explore the Chinese medicinal compatibility patterns or rules in the treatment or control of breast cancer recurrence and metastasis. METHODS: This study was based on the herbs recorded in Pharmacopoeia of the People's Republic of China, and the literature sources from Chinese Journal Net and China Master Dissertations Full-text Database (1990 - 2010) to analyze the compatibility rule of the prescription. Each Chinese herb was listed according to the selected medicinal formulae and the added information was organized to establish a database. The frequency and the association rules of the prescription patterns were analyzed using the SPSS Clenmentine Data Mining System. An initial statistical analysis was carried out to categorize the herbs according to their medicinal types and dosage, natures, flavors, channel tropism, and functions. Based on the categorization, the frequencies of occurrence were computed. RESULTS: The main prescriptive features from the selected formulae of the mining data are: (1) warm or cold herbs in the Five Properties category; sweet or bitter herbs in the Five Flavors category and with affinity to the liver meridian are the most frequently prescribed in the 96 medicinal formulae; (2) herbs with tonifying and replenishing, blood-activating and stasis-resolving, spleen-strengthening and dampness-resolving or heat-clearing and detoxicating functions that are frequently prescribed; (3) herbs with blood-tonifying, yin-tonifying, spleen-strengthening and dampness-resolving, heat-clearing and detoxicating, and blood-activating with stasis-resolving functions that are interrelated and prescribed in combination with qi-tonifying herbs. CONCLUSIONS: The results indicate that there is a close relationship between recurrence and metastasis of breast cancer with liver dysfunctions. These prescriptions focus on the herbs for nourishing the yin-blood, and emolliating and regulating the liver which seems to be the key element in the treatment process. Meanwhile, the use of qi-tonifying and spleen-strengthening herbs also forms the basis of prescription patterns.

BACKGROUND: This retrospective cross-sectional study aimed to investigate the relationship between Chinese medicine (CM) dietary patterns (hot, neutral, and cold) and the incidence of breast cancer among Chinese women in Hong Kong. METHODS: Breast cancer cases (n = 202) and healthy controls (n = 202) were matched according to demographics. Chinese women residing in Hong Kong for the past 7 years were recruited by media advertisements (e.g., via newspapers, radio, and posters). The control participants were recruited by convenience sampling from health workshops held in clinics and communities of 15 districts of Hong Kong. After completing test-retest reliability, all participants were asked to complete diet pattern questionnaires about their food preferences and dietary patterns. The Student's unpaired t test, Chi square test, and logistic regression were conducted using SPSS software. RESULTS: Three major CM dietary patterns were identified: hot, neutral, and cold. The participants with breast cancer exhibited a stronger preference for hot food than the control group (Chi square test, P < 0.001). A higher frequency of breast cancer was associated with a higher frequency of dining out for breakfast (4-5 times per week, Chi square test, P = 0.015; 6-7 times per week, Chi square test, P < 0.001) and lunch (4-5 times per week, Chi square test, P < 0.001; 6-7 times per week, Chi square test, P = 0.006). The participants with no history of breast cancer consumed CM supplements and Guangdong soups (1-2 times per week, Chi square test, P = 0.05; >3 times per week, Chi square test, P < 0.001) more frequently than those with breast cancer. CONCLUSIONS: Non-breast cancer participants adopted a neutral (healthy and balanced) dietary pattern, and consumed CM supplements and Guangdong soups more frequently.

Angiogenesis is crucial for cancer initiation, development and metastasis. Identifying natural botanicals targeting angiogenesis has been paid much attention for drug discovery in recent years, with the advantage of increased safety. Isoliquiritigenin (ISL) is a dietary chalcone-type flavonoid with various anti-cancer activities. However, little is known about the anti-angiogenic activity of isoliquiritigenin and its underlying mechanisms. Herein, we found that ISL significantly inhibited the VEGF-induced proliferation of human umbilical vein endothelial cells (HUVECs) at non-toxic concentration. A series of angiogenesis processes including tube formation, invasion and migration abilities of HUVECs were also interrupted by ISL in vitro. Furthermore, ISL suppressed sprout formation from VEGF-treated aortic rings in an ex-vivo model. Molecular mechanisms study demonstrated that ISL could significantly inhibit VEGF expression in breast cancer cells via promoting HIF-1α (Hypoxia inducible factor-1α) proteasome degradation and directly interacted with VEGFR-2 to block its kinase activity. In vivo studies further showed that ISL administration could inhibit breast cancer growth and neoangiogenesis accompanying with suppressed VEGF/VEGFR-2 signaling, elevated apoptosis ratio and little toxicity effects. Molecular docking simulation indicated that ISL could stably form hydrogen bonds and aromatic interactions within the ATP-binding region of VEGFR-2. Taken together, our study shed light on the potential application of ISL as a novel natural inhibitor for cancer angiogenesis via the VEGF/VEGFR-2 pathway. Future studies of ISL for chemoprevention or chemosensitization against breast cancer are thus warranted.
